質問編集履歴

2

コメントへの回答

2023/11/03 14:38

投稿

penpen88
penpen88

スコア18

test CHANGED
File without changes
test CHANGED
@@ -39,10 +39,41 @@
39
39
 
40
40
  ### 試したこと
41
41
 
42
- 初めて playsound を入れた際、
42
+ 初めて playsound を入れた際、
43
-
44
43
  playsound is relying on another python subprocess. Please use `pip install pygobject` if you want playsound to run more efficiently.
45
44
  というエラーが出てきたため、指示通り pygobject もインストールしました。
46
45
 
47
46
 
47
+ ・コメントにて、pyとmp3が同じフォルダ内なので、
48
+ playsound.playsound("/home/tatodestino/4.mp3") ではないのでしょうか
49
+ との回答をいただきましたが、下記エラーコードが出ました。
48
50
 
51
+ ```
52
+ Traceback (most recent call last):
53
+ File "/home/tatodestino/.local/lib/python3.10/site-packages/playsound.py", line 261, in <module>
54
+ playsound(argv[1])
55
+ File "/home/tatodestino/.local/lib/python3.10/site-packages/playsound.py", line 163, in _playsoundNix
56
+ gi.require_version('Gst', '1.0')
57
+ File "/usr/lib/python3/dist-packages/gi/__init__.py", line 126, in require_version
58
+ raise ValueError('Namespace %s not available' % namespace)
59
+ ValueError: Namespace Gst not available
60
+ Traceback (most recent call last):
61
+ File "/home/tatodestino/time.py", line 38, in
62
+ <module>
63
+ playsound.playsound("/home/tatodestino/4.mp3")
64
+ File "/home/tatodestino/.local/lib/python3.10/site-packages/playsound.py", line 254, in <lambda>
65
+ playsound = lambda sound, block = True: _playsoundAnotherPython('/usr/bin/python3', sound, block, macOS = False)
66
+ File "/home/tatodestino/.local/lib/python3.10/site-packages/playsound.py", line 229, in _playsoundAnotherPython
67
+ t.join()
68
+ File "/home/tatodestino/.local/lib/python3.10/site-packages/playsound.py", line 218, in join
69
+ raise self.exc
70
+ File "/home/tatodestino/.local/lib/python3.10/site-packages/playsound.py", line 211, in run
71
+ self.ret = self._target(*self._args, **self._kwargs)
72
+ File "/home/tatodestino/.local/lib/python3.10/site-packages/playsound.py", line 226, in <lambda>
73
+ t = PropogatingThread(target = lambda: check_call([otherPython, playsoundPath, _handlePathOSX(sound) if macOS else sound]))
74
+ File "/usr/lib/python3.10/subprocess.py", line 369, in check_call
75
+ raise CalledProcessError(retcode, cmd)
76
+ subprocess.CalledProcessError: Command '['/usr/bin/python3', '/home/tatodestino/.local/lib/python3.10/site-packages/playsound.py', '/home/tatodestino/4.mp3']' returned non-zero exit status 1.
77
+ ```
78
+
79
+

1

a

2023/11/03 13:53

投稿

penpen88
penpen88

スコア18

test CHANGED
File without changes
test CHANGED
@@ -9,6 +9,8 @@
9
9
  ・webスクレイピング中に、ある条件で通知が来るシステムを稼働していますが、夜に条件が来たら起こしてほしいので、大音量で音を鳴らしたい、という目的です。
10
10
 
11
11
  ・windows10(当PC)、mac(別のPC)では正常に再生してくれます。
12
+
13
+ ・実行コードのpyファイルと、mp3ファイルは同じフォルダに入っています。("ユーザー名"の中)
12
14
 
13
15
  ### 発生している問題・エラーメッセージ
14
16